forked from Imagelibrary/binutils-gdb
Rearrange symbol_create parameters
These functions take an offset within frag, frag within section, and section parameter. So it makes sense to order the parameters as section, frag, offset. * symbols.h (symbol_new, symbol_create, local_symbol_make), (symbol_temp_new): Arrange params as section, frag, offset. * symbols.c: Adjust to suit. * as.c: Likewise. * cgen.c: Likewise. * dwarf2dbg.c: Likewise. * ecoff.c: Likewise. * expr.c: Likewise. * itbl-ops.c: Likewise. * read.c: Likewise. * stabs.c: Likewise. * subsegs.c: Likewise. * config/obj-coff.c: Likewise. * config/obj-elf.c: Likewise. * config/obj-macho.c: Likewise. * config/tc-aarch64.c: Likewise. * config/tc-alpha.c: Likewise. * config/tc-arc.c: Likewise. * config/tc-arm.c: Likewise. * config/tc-avr.c: Likewise. * config/tc-cr16.c: Likewise. * config/tc-cris.c: Likewise. * config/tc-csky.c: Likewise. * config/tc-dlx.c: Likewise. * config/tc-hppa.c: Likewise. * config/tc-i386.c: Likewise. * config/tc-ia64.c: Likewise. * config/tc-m32r.c: Likewise. * config/tc-m68k.c: Likewise. * config/tc-mips.c: Likewise. * config/tc-mmix.c: Likewise. * config/tc-mn10200.c: Likewise. * config/tc-mn10300.c: Likewise. * config/tc-nds32.c: Likewise. * config/tc-nios2.c: Likewise. * config/tc-ppc.c: Likewise. * config/tc-riscv.c: Likewise. * config/tc-s390.c: Likewise. * config/tc-sh.c: Likewise. * config/tc-tic4x.c: Likewise. * config/tc-tic54x.c: Likewise. * config/tc-xtensa.c: Likewise.
This commit is contained in:
@@ -621,14 +621,14 @@ tic4x_insert_reg (const char *regname, int regnum)
|
||||
char buf[32];
|
||||
int i;
|
||||
|
||||
symbol_table_insert (symbol_new (regname, reg_section, (valueT) regnum,
|
||||
&zero_address_frag));
|
||||
symbol_table_insert (symbol_new (regname, reg_section,
|
||||
&zero_address_frag, regnum));
|
||||
for (i = 0; regname[i]; i++)
|
||||
buf[i] = ISLOWER (regname[i]) ? TOUPPER (regname[i]) : regname[i];
|
||||
buf[i] = '\0';
|
||||
|
||||
symbol_table_insert (symbol_new (buf, reg_section, (valueT) regnum,
|
||||
&zero_address_frag));
|
||||
symbol_table_insert (symbol_new (buf, reg_section,
|
||||
&zero_address_frag, regnum));
|
||||
}
|
||||
|
||||
static void
|
||||
@@ -637,7 +637,7 @@ tic4x_insert_sym (const char *symname, int value)
|
||||
symbolS *symbolP;
|
||||
|
||||
symbolP = symbol_new (symname, absolute_section,
|
||||
(valueT) value, &zero_address_frag);
|
||||
&zero_address_frag, value);
|
||||
SF_SET_LOCAL (symbolP);
|
||||
symbol_table_insert (symbolP);
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user